A picture of a German locksmith professional, 1451. Locksmithing is the scientific research as well as art of making as well as defeating locks. Locksmithing is a conventional profession as well as in several countries requires conclusion of an instruction. The degree of formal education and learning lawfully needed varies from country to country from none in all, to a simple training certification awarded by a company, to a complete diploma from an engineering university (such as in Australia), in enhancement to time invested functioning as an apprentice.

Historically, locksmith professionals would certainly make the whole lock, helping hours hand reducing screws and also doing much file-work. Lock designs ended up being considerably a lot more made complex in the 18th century, as well as locksmith professionals commonly focused on repairing or developing locks. After the increase of low-cost automation, the vast majority of locks are fixed by swapping components or like-for-like substitute or upgraded to modern mass-production items.

In terms of physical security, a locksmith's job frequently includes making a determination of the level of danger to an individual or organization and then suggesting as well as implementing suitable mixes of equipment as well as plans to develop "safety and security layers" which go beyond the reasonable gain to a trespasser or assailant.

Because each layer comes at a cost to the client, the application of proper degrees without exceeding sensible costs to the consumer is typically extremely important and requires a knowledgeable and knowledgeable locksmith professional to determine. While a handyman can additionally mount and also replace locks, locksmiths are specialists whose involvement might be desirable for several reason.

In addition, locksmiths in many locations are called for by regulation to go through training as well as preserve accreditation. Locksmith professional regulation by nation [edit] Australia [modify] In Australia, potential locksmiths are required to take a Technical and also Further Education And Learning (TAFE) program in locksmithing, completion of which brings about issuance of a Degree 3 Australian Qualifications Structure certificate, and finish an instruction.

Apprenticeships can last one to four years. Program needs are variable: there is a minimal requirements variation that needs less total training systems, as well as a fuller variation that teaches a lot more innovative abilities, yet takes even more time to complete.

United States [edit] Fifteen states in the United States need licensure for locksmiths. Nassau Region as well as New York City City in New York City State, and also Hillsborough Area and also Miami-Dade Area in Florida have their very own licensing regulations.
